Hot Water Extraction

What is hot water extraction?

Hot water extraction carpet cleaning works like this:  First, a powerful machine heats water in the cleaning truck. Trained carpet cleaning experts use a professional hot water extraction cleaning machine to inject water and a cleaning solution into the carpet and remove dirt. The machine then extracts the solution and the hot water back out of the carpet so that it can dry quickly. While there is visible steam from the hot water, it is the water doing the cleaning.

How is Renting a “Steam Machine” Different from Getting a Professional Service?

  • Dirt Removal. The most important step of a professional carpet cleaning is not the hot water extraction, but vacuuming the carpet before the hot water cleaning. It is absolutely necessary to thoroughly vacuum the carpet and remove as much dirt as possible from the carpet before any wet cleaning. Professional carpet cleaners like Heaven's Best has powerful truck mounted vacuums that remove much more dirt from carpets then home vacuums.
  • Drying Power. Rental machines are just not as powerful and effective as professional, truck-mounted machines. One area where this is apparent is in drying the carpet. To prevent mold, stains, damage and overall discomfort, it is important to get carpets as dry as possible after cleaning. With professional cleaning, carpets may be damp for a day or two afterward, while steam machines can leave carpets damp for much longer. Rental machines simply do not have the power to get carpets as dry as professional machines.

What to expect

When we arrive at your home, we’ll make sure that you agree with the services being provided. We’ll then move any furniture to provide a thorough, deep cleaning. However, some furniture cannot be moved, such as entertainment centers or beds.

Hot water extraction carpet cleaning is easy to understand. First, a powerful machine heats water to 210 degrees. While the machine warms the water, we pre-vacuum the entire floor. This is an important step that allows us to pickup any loose dirt that’s on the carpet. Next we’ll apply our citrus based cleaning solution to the carpet. This step helps us pre treat and remove most stains and dirt buildup. Our cleaning solution does not use harsh chemicals. All active ingredients are safe for pets, people, and the environment. Once our solution is applied, any dirt or grime will break down, allowing us to extract it out with our powerful extraction equipment. If there are any areas that need special attention, we apply our cleaner a second time and remove both the cleaner and dirt.

The last step we take is to rake the carpet with a unique carpet rake. This helps the carpet fibers stand up, the carpet dries faster, and will help make your carpet look like new.
